1.soft-witted - (of especially persons) lacking sense or understanding or judgmentnitwitted, witless, senselessstupid - lacking or marked by lack of intellectual acuity
soft-witted
adj
Synonyms for soft-witted
adj (of especially persons) lacking sense or understanding or judgment